Why this matters
Oily and acne-prone skin does not need one universal sunscreen finish. Some people want less shine, while others want a comfortable hydrated look that still layers under makeup. The useful filter in 2026 is wearability: pick a formula you will apply at the right amount and reapply without avoiding it because of pilling, greasiness, or a visible cast.
If your routine already includes a salicylic acid cleanser or a retinoid, the sunscreen layer is where most routines quietly fail. Pilling, breakouts along the jawline, and a shiny midday face usually trace back to texture mismatch, not SPF strength.

What to look for in Korean sunscreen for oily, acne-prone skin
Water-gel or fluid texture, not cream
Cream-based sunscreens sit on top of sebum instead of absorbing into it, which is exactly why they pill by noon. A water-gel or fluid base absorbs in under a minute and layers cleanly over serums without balling up.
Choose the finish you will keep wearing
Oily skin is not one finish preference. A natural or semi-matte formula can help reduce visible shine, while a serum sunscreen can suit someone who prefers a hydrated glow. Check reviewer feedback for pilling, makeup layering, and whether the formula stays comfortable after a few hours.
Pore-safe supporting ingredients
Niacinamide, centella asiatica, and panthenol calm irritation without adding weight. Heavy plant oils and dense silicone blends do the opposite, even at SPF50+.
SPF50+ PA++++ as the daily standard
SPF50+ PA++++ is the protection level used for every pick in this 2026 guide. It gives high UVB and UVA coverage for daily exposure.
How it behaves under makeup
A sunscreen that pills the second a cushion foundation goes on top is a sunscreen you'll stop reapplying. The best oily-skin formulas dry down enough to take powder or cushion without balling.
A quick routine note: a toner built for large pores and oily skin can be a useful lightweight layer before sunscreen. Let each layer dry before applying the next one to reduce pilling.

What to avoid
- A finish you dislike after two hours. A sunscreen that feels too shiny, too dry, or too tinted is less likely to be reapplied.
- A visible white cast. Test clear formulas in daylight and give tone-up products a few minutes to settle before deciding whether the tint works for your skin tone.
- Too many new products at once. Introduce one sunscreen at a time so it is easier to identify a formula that does not suit your skin.

Can I use Korean sunscreen over salicylic acid or retinoids?
Yes, sunscreen belongs at the end of a morning routine after your leave-on skincare steps. Let each layer dry before applying sunscreen to reduce pilling.
How often should I reapply sunscreen on oily skin?
Reapply every two hours during direct sun exposure, regardless of skin type. A finish you enjoy wearing makes regular reapplication easier.
